This amazing melt-in-the-middle Chocolate Pudding is quick and easy to prepare. Steam the pudding in your slow cooker or a pot and serve with rich chocolate sauce – delicious!

Grease a 2 pint pudding basin (or small glass bowl) and place a small piece of baking paper in the centre.
Add all the pudding ingredients to a bowl and beat together until you have a smooth batter.
Spoon half into the prepared bowl and add 4-5 chocolate truffles in the middle.
Cover with remaining batter and level.
Cut a square piece of foil, make a pleat in the middle and cover the bowl, securing with an elastic band. Fashion a handle with string so you can lift the pudding easily.
Put a jam jar lid in the base of your slow cooker and place the pudding on top.
Add boiling water to the slow cooker to come halfway up the bowl. Cover and cook on high for 90 minutes or until the pudding feels firm to the touch. Keep warm.
Make the sauce
Heat the chocolate chips and cream, stirring, until you have a smooth chocolate sauce. If the sauce is too thick you can add a little more cream or milk. Stir in the Baileys and vanilla extract.
Serve your Chocolate Pudding
